A new 3-D Virtual Environment (3DVE) system named 0"QuViE/P" has been proposed in this paper, which can greatly enhance the quality of service (QoS) that users actually feel as good as possible, when the resources for computers and networks are limited. To do this, therefore, we focus on characteristics of the user's perceptual quality evaluation on 3-D objects. In this paper, we propose an effective QoS control scheme that introduces a relationship between system's internal quality parameters and user's perceptual quality parameters. This scheme can appropriately maintain quality and functions for users and is expected to drastically improve convenience when using 3DVE under the situation that resources are limited. Experimental results obtained from using a prototype of QuViE/P show effectiveness of our scheme as follows: Even when computer resource is reduced to 30% of the required amount, our proposed scheme can preferentially keep quality of important objects. Moreover it continues to provide quality and functions that user requires. Whereas in traditional QoS control scheme, objects of importance disappeared in similar situation.
